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Pontypool & New Inn to Hitchin start from as little as £27.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Pontypool & New Inn to Hitchin start from £100.30 one way, or £101.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Pontypool & New Inn to Hitchin are available for £149.50 one way, or £299.00 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ities

Although Pontypool & New Inn may not boast extensive facilities, it does provide essential services for travellers. While there is no ticket office, 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ting tickets. These machines cater to various payment methods, though it's important to note that cash is not accepted. Worried about access and support? The station is equipped with customer help points for immediate assistance at platforms and a help point for more extensive inquiries. Unfortunately, step-free access is limited due to a flight of 24 steps leading to the platforms, so travellers with mobility challenges should plan accordingly.

If you are someone who enjoys cycling, you'll be happy to know there are 14 cycle parking spaces available, spread across two locations for your convenience. However, the station lacks amenities like toilets, waiting rooms, and refreshment facilities. On the security side, there is CCTV monitoring to ensure passenger safety.

Facilities and Services at Hitchin Station

Hitchin station is well-equipped to cater to your travel needs. The ticket office operates from 06:15 to 20:00 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 07:15 to 18:30 on Sundays. Grab your tickets from the office or take advantage of the ticket machines located throughout the station, which are accessible to all and include options for purchasing tickets with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.

For those prioritizing accessibility, the station is a Category A location, offering step-free access to all platforms. Additionally, staff-operated ramps are available to assist passengers with buggies, wheelchairs, or heavy luggage. Although there are no waiting rooms, seating areas ensure comfort while you wait for your train. Moreover, services like CCTV, ATMs, and refreshment facilities enhance your station experience.
